A man is hospitalized after surgery in which both lower extremities were amputated because of injuries sustained during military service.The nurse should recognize his need to grieve for what type of loss?

A) Maturational loss.
B) Situational loss.
C) Perceived loss.
D) Uncomplicated loss.

Amputated

The surgical removal of a body part, typically a limb or digit, often as a result of injury, disease, or surgery.

Situational Loss

A form of grief or mourning that occurs in response to a specific situation, such as the loss of a job, relationship, or health status.
